what color was it before?

The car was black before. The previous owner was rear ended and there was enough force to send him into the tail of another car. Luckily it was only the front and rear bumpers that were damaged and not the frame. :) I replaced everything, shaved emblems and repainted it black with light metallic blue flakes.

I love your exhaust. It really matches the car. 8)

Thanks. 2.5 inch with a high flow cat, high flow resonator and a fart can to finish it off :P. I put the high flow resonator on because it deepens it. I did it so it wouldn't have that high pitched whiny sound a lot of import drivers have put onto theirs. There's headers, intake, cam/camshaft, and uhhhh...that's pretty much it. Not going to do anything else except rims and maybe a better motor in the near-future. Probably a b18c with a greddy turbo kit. (7lbs) That will be good enough. Don't want to deal too much with tuning.
